Just passed the CQA by Hazelnut_coffee_1995 in ASQ

[–]Hazelnut_coffee_1995[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

The questions were aligned with the BOK but honestly the BOK only helped with knowing what to focus on but I barely referenced it when studying.

I just read the book, used the question bank, kept an “error” log of any missed or barely passed questions and worked from there. I also go very familiar with the glossary. And yes, some of the practice questions are straight up incorrect. Which is frustrating because you’d expect ASQ to QC their material.
